Pride Month: How to be allies of diversity inside and outside the office?

Build a equitable, inclusive and collaborative workplace, in which each person contributes from their experience, knowledge and way of being is essential. At GE, our hope is that, not just this month, but every day, we are community allies to provide a safe, welcoming, empathetic and respectful environment for all people. But how can you be an ally of the LGBTQIA+ community inside and outside the office?

  • Be willing to listen: Often, we want to speak and bring words of comfort to people. But being really willing to listen, with an open mind and without prejudice, is the wisest thing to do in many cases.
  • Learn about the theme: Empathetically and proactively seek to understand the issues and difficulties facing the LGBTQIA+ community.
  • When observing an aggression, act!: When witnessing a situation of aggression (physical and/or verbal), remove the person from the place. Away from danger, witness and seek help for more severe measures. Remember that homophobia and transphobia are crimes!

The tolerance and respect They help us foster an inclusive and diverse culture and, consequently, create a workspace where everyone feels safe and accepted to develop. Employees can give their full potential in an environment where they feel uninhibited and free. In this context, it is important to encourage employees to act and think without prejudice, understanding that we can all contribute a differential value for what we are as people.

Taking action and being an active agent of this change is key, and including labor policies that are in accordance with this perspective, too. For this reason, for several years now, as a company, we have devoted ourselves to the vindication of LGBTIQA+ rights and we are part of Pride Connection in Argentina, Colombia and Peru, a network that seeks to promote inclusive work spaces for sexual diversity and generate ties for the attraction of LGBTI talent.

The diversity of beliefs, opinions and ideas gives rise to new perceptions and points of view, which opens the panorama to questions that are not usually considered or raised. Encouraging this reasoning both within organizations and outside of them is the path we must follow to achieve a fairer society that provides full opportunities and equal conditions for all people.
